Region's stand-out films honoured at awards ceremony

Hotly-contested Muhr Awards Reward Region's Best Filmmakers 

Dubai, December 18, 2014 – The hotly-contested annual Muhr Awards have once again rewarded the region's best filmmakers for their dedicated work in the industry at the Dubai International Film Festival's 11th edition. The Muhr Awards were presented to recipients by His Highness Sheikh Mansour Bin Mohammed Bin Rashid Al Maktoum during a glittering ceremony at the Burj Al Arab. 

Categories in this year's Awards are the Muhr Feature (for non-fiction and fiction feature films); the Muhr Emirati and Muhr Shorts. An array of competitive entries were received, making judging the films tougher than ever. 

The ceremony started by announcing the winner of the inaugural Ministry of Interior Award for Best Societal Screenplay, which goes to Emirati filmmaker Saeed Salmeen Al Murry for his project “Going to Heaven”. The inaugural Award will bestow a prize of $100,000 for Al Murry's screenplay which this year addressed issues of child welfare.

The Awards were established in 2006, to foster and reward artistic excellence from within the Arab world and beyond. The coveted prize award funds that have been used to create some of the globe's most unique films.

The 2014 winners are:

MOI Award

Saeed Salmeen Al Murry for “Going to Heaven”

Muhr Emirati

Best Jury Prize
Mohammed Swaidan
LA CONFESSION (THE CONFESSION)
France & UAE

Best Film
Aisha Alzaabi
AL BU'AD AL AKHAR (THE OTHER DIMENSION)
UAE

Muhr Short

Special Mention
Rami Yasin
FI AL WAQT AL DAE'A (IN OVERTIME)
Jordan & Palestine

Special Mention
Karim Rahbani 
WITH THY SPIRIT
Lebanon

Best Jury Prize
Sahim Omar Kalifa
THE DEEBAD HUNTER
Belgium & UAE

Best Film
Hinde Boujemaa
ET ROMEO EPOUSA JULIETTE (...AND ROMEO MARRIED JULIETTE)
Tunisia

Muhr Feature

Special Mention
Hisham Zaman
BREV TIL KONGEN (LETTER TO THE KING)
UAE & Norway

Special Mention
Yacine Mohamed Benelhadj
RANI MIYET (I'M DEAD)
Algeria & UAE

Special Mention
Yahya Alabdallah
AL MAJLIS (THE COUNCIL)
Jordan & UAE

Best Jury Prize
Salim Abu Jabal
ROSHMIA
Palestine, United Arab Emirates, Qatar & Syria

Best Non-Fiction Film
Nujoom Al Ghanem
SAMMA QARRIBAH (NEARBY SKY)
UAE

Best Fiction Film
Khadija Al-Salami 
ANA NOJOOM BENT ALASHERAH WAMOTALAGAH (I AM NOJOOM, AGE 10 AND DIVORCED) 
Yemen, UAE & France
